Abstract
An analytical expression for the angular dependence of the Rayleigh wave velocity on polycrystalline metals with small anisotropy is obtained with the use of the variational method. For a Poisson ratio v = ¼ this corrects the result obtained by M. L. Smith & F. A. Dahlen ( J. Geophys Res . 78, 3321-3333 (1973)), by using the same method. Application is made to the Rayleigh wave velocity in hot rolled aluminium and steel sheets. The results are shown to agree with the exact results obtained earlier for propagation along the principal axes of weakly textured metals with orthorhombic symmetry, this being the symmetry of rolled sheet. The results can be applied to the non-destructive measurement of residual stress in metals.
